#50594f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50594f is composed of 31.4% red, 34.9%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.2%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 114 degrees, a saturation of 6% and a lightness of 32.9%. #50594f color hex could be obtained by blending #a0b29e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#50594f color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#50594f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50594f has RGB values of R:80, G:89,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5265743.
